Company Profile: Zhejiang Wenda Electronics Co., Ltd.

Zhejiang Wenda Electronics Co., Ltd. is located at the southern foot of the beautiful Yandang Mountain - Yueqing Bay Lingang Economic Development Zone. Founded in March 2007, it is a private joint-stock enterprise with more than 500 employees. The factory covers an area of more than 10,000 square meters and a construction area of more than 25,000 square meters.

The company integrates product research and development, manufacturing, and marketing, and can independently design and develop various types of precision electronic connectors, new energy connectors, electronic and automotive wiring harnesses, and other products. We possess high-speed precision punching machines, precision injection molding machines, fully automatic integrated assembly lines, and high-tech testing equipment like ROHS testers and film thickness detectors.

What are the primary advantages of the HY2.0 pitch over smaller 1.25mm connectors?

The HY2.0 (2.0mm pitch) offers a superior balance between miniaturization and current-carrying capacity. While 1.25mm connectors are excellent for high-density signals, the 2.0mm pitch allows for thicker gauge wires (up to 24 AWG), enabling higher power delivery and better mechanical retention, which is critical in high-vibration automotive and industrial environments.

How does Zhejiang Wenda ensure signal integrity in high-frequency applications?

We utilize precision stamping with high-conductivity copper alloys and offer selective gold plating (up to 30u"). Our design team also performs signal integrity simulations to minimize crosstalk and insertion loss, making our HY2.0 connectors suitable for high-speed digital interfaces.

Are these connectors compatible with automated SMT pick-and-place processes?

Yes. Our horizontal and vertical SMT versions are designed with flat top surfaces and available in tape-and-reel packaging (with polyimide pick-up tabs) to facilitate seamless integration into high-speed automated assembly lines.

What testing protocols are used for the IATF 16949 compliant products?

Automotive-grade connectors undergo thermal shock testing (-40°C to +125°C), salt spray corrosion testing (up to 96 hours), and mechanical life testing (mating cycles). We also employ 100% CCD automated optical inspection to verify pin coplanarity and housing integrity.
